The Economic and Cultural Impact of Water Leaks

Water leaks not only waste a precious resource but also have significant economic and cultural implications. According to the U.S. Environmental Protection Agency (EPA), a single dripping faucet can waste up to 20 gallons of water per day, while a leaky toilet can waste up to 200 gallons per day. These unnecessary water losses can lead to increased water bills, damage to property, and even health risks due to mold and mildew growth.

In addition to the economic costs, water leaks also have cultural and social implications. For example, in areas experiencing drought or water scarcity, every gallon counted. In such situations, stopping water leaks becomes a matter of survival and community resilience. Moreover, water leaks can also compromise the safety and comfort of residents, especially in apartment buildings or shared living spaces.

Step 1: Determine the Source of the Leak

Identify the source of the water leak by visually inspecting the affected area and checking for signs of moisture, water stains, or mineral deposits. You can also use a water leak detection tool or hire a professional to help you locate the source of the leak.

Step 2: Assess the Severity of the Leak

Evaluate the severity of the leak by measuring the rate at which water is flowing from the leak. You can use a bucket or a measuring container to collect water samples and estimate the leak rate. This information will help you determine the urgency of the repair and the necessary materials and tools required.

Step 3: Choose the Right Materials and Tools

Select the right materials and tools for the repair job, depending on the type and severity of the leak. Common materials and tools include pipe wrenches, slip wrenches, pipe tape, and repair clamps. You may also need specialized tools, such as thermal imaging cameras or moisture meters, to help you detect and diagnose the leak.

Step 4: Shut Off the Water Supply

Shut off the water supply to the affected area before starting the repair. This will prevent further water damage and make it easier to locate and repair the leak. You can use a main shut-off valve, a hose bib valve, or a stopcock to shut off the water supply.

Step 5: Repair the Leak

Use the chosen materials and tools to repair the leak, following the manufacturer's instructions and the industry's best practices. Apply pipe tape or repair clamps to the affected pipe, reassemble the pipe fitting, or replace the leaking component entirely. Make sure to test the repair by checking for leaks and verifying the functionality of the pipe system.
